NEPAL'S RELATIONS WITH INDIA INCOMPARABLE: KAMAL THAPA

New Delhi - Nepal's relations with India is
"incomparable" and its growing ties with China have not
been at the cost of India, Nepalese Deputy Prime Minister
Kamal Thapa stated on Friday, seeking support from both
its neighbours to tide over the "most difficult" period
in its recent history.
On a three-day visit, Thapa said there was no threat to
Prime Minister K P Sharma Oli's Government though Maoist
leader Prachanda had set certain conditions to continue
his party's support to the coalition regime.
Fielding questions on a range of issues at a media
interaction, Thapa, also Nepal's Foreign Minister, said
his Government was committed to resolve the contentious\
Madhesi issue and a high-level panel has been set up to
suggest within three months ways to resolve their
demands.
